HC Deb 23 June 1964 vol 697 c37W
Mr. A. Lewis

asked the Chancellor of the Exchequer in view of the fact that since nationalisation the various State-owned industries have paid £2,462.8 million in interest charges, what estimate he has made of the total profit of the nationalised industries if no interest rates had been paid and if the same percentage interest rate as that received by depositors in the Post Office Savings Bank had been paid by way of interest.

Mr. Green

When I replied to the hon. Member for Bury St. Edmunds (Mr. Eldon Griffiths) on 17th June I gave the financial results of the nationalised industries both before and after paying interest. I would prefer not to speculate on what the results would have been had some different rate of interest applied.
